Question Interpretation vs Quick Answering

In the fast-paced world of modern education, students often face a choice between deep question interpretation and the speed of quick answering. While interpretation ensures accuracy by decoding the true intent behind a prompt, quick answering relies on mental agility and rapid recall to manage tight deadlines and high-pressure exams.

What is Question Interpretation?

The analytical process of deconstructing a prompt to understand its constraints, nuances, and underlying requirements.

  • Interpretation involves identifying 'command words' like compare, evaluate, or justify to determine the required response depth.
  • It prevents 'answering the wrong question,' a common pitfall where students provide correct information that doesn't fit the prompt.
  • Skilled interpreters look for hidden constraints, such as word limits or specific theoretical lenses requested by the examiner.
  • This approach often utilizes 'active reading' strategies, such as underlining keywords and sketching out a logical flow before writing.
  • In professional settings, interpretation is the bridge between a client's vague request and a successful project delivery.

What is Quick Answering?

A strategy focused on immediate response generation through pattern recognition, intuition, and efficient time management.

  • Quick answering is essential for standardized multiple-choice tests where the ratio of questions to minutes is high.
  • It relies heavily on 'heuristics'—mental shortcuts that allow the brain to find the most likely answer rapidly.
  • This method prioritizes 'fluency,' or the ease with which information is retrieved from long-term memory.
  • Speed-focused learners often use the 'process of elimination' to narrow down choices within seconds.
  • In high-stakes environments like emergency rooms or stock trading, the ability to answer quickly can be more valuable than deep analysis.

Detailed Comparison

The Depth of Deconstruction

Question interpretation is about slowing down to speed up later. By spending the first few minutes of an exam period truly dissecting what a prompt is asking, a student ensures that every sentence they write adds value. This process acts as a filter, removing irrelevant information and focusing the mind on the specific 'evidence' required to satisfy a complex rubric.

The Efficiency of Intuition

Quick answering is a survival skill in the modern classroom where 'timed conditions' are the norm. It leverages the brain's ability to recognize familiar patterns without needing to rethink the underlying logic every single time. When a student has mastered a subject, their quick answers aren't just guesses; they are the result of highly refined intuition that bypasses unnecessary deliberation.

The Trap of the 'Easy' Answer

The biggest danger of quick answering is the 'misread.' Many exams are designed with 'distractors'—answers that look correct at a glance but are logically flawed upon closer inspection. Interpretation serves as the safety net that catches these traps, while quick answering often walks right into them in exchange for saving thirty seconds on the clock.

Strategic Integration

Mastery involves knowing when to switch gears between these two modes. For example, a student might use quick answering for the first half of a test to bank extra time, then pivot to rigorous interpretation for the high-mark essay questions at the end. Successful learners treat their cognitive speed like a manual transmission, shifting based on the complexity of the road ahead.

Common Misconceptions

Myth

Fast talkers/writers are smarter.

Reality

Speed is a measure of processing, not necessarily intelligence; deep thinkers often require more time to process the layers of a question before responding.

Myth

Reading the question once is enough.

Reality

Research shows that reading a question twice—once for the gist and once for the specific constraints—drastically improves accuracy scores.

Myth

Quick answering is just guessing.

Reality

In an expert, quick answering is 'recognition-primed decision making,' where the brain accesses a vast library of past experiences in milliseconds.

Myth

Complex questions always require long answers.

Reality

Often, the best interpretation of a complex question leads to a very concise, surgical answer that addresses the core issue directly.

Frequently Asked Questions

How can I get better at interpreting questions under pressure?
Try the 'CUB' method: Circle the command verb, Underline the key content requirements, and Box the constraints (like 'using two examples'). Doing this physically on the paper takes only seconds but forces your brain to process the instructions visually and kinesthetically, making it much harder to skip over a crucial detail.
Does quick answering lead to worse long-term learning?
If used exclusively, yes. Quick answering often stays in the realm of 'rote memorization.' However, when used as part of 'retrieval practice' (like using flashcards), it actually strengthens memory pathways. The key is to ensure you eventually understand the 'why' behind the quick answer during your review sessions.
Why do I always realize I misread a question AFTER I submit the work?
This is usually due to 'confirmation bias.' Once you start writing an answer based on an initial (and possibly wrong) impression, your brain filters out any clues that you might be off-track. To fight this, take a 10-second 'sanity break' halfway through your answer to re-read the prompt and make sure you're still actually answering it.
Is speed or accuracy more important in professional life?
It varies by industry. In a legal firm, an 'interpreted' answer is vital because one missed word can change a contract's meaning. In customer support, 'quick answering' is often prioritized to handle volume. However, the highest-paid professionals are usually those who can perform deep interpretation at the speed of others' quick answering.
How do standardized tests exploit quick answering?
Test makers include 'attractors'—choices that contain keywords from the question but are logically incorrect. They know that students moving too fast will see the familiar word and pick the answer immediately without verifying the context. Slowing down to interpret the logic of each choice is the only way to avoid these traps.
Should I change my answer if I have time at the end?
The old advice was 'stick with your first gut instinct,' but modern research suggests that if you have a specific reason to doubt your first answer (like a new interpretation of the question), you should change it. Most students who change their answers move from 'wrong' to 'right' because the second look is more analytical.
Can AI help with question interpretation?
AI is excellent at summarizing prompts, but it can also hallucinate or miss subtle human nuances. You can use it to practice by asking an AI to 'explain what this prompt is asking for in three different ways,' which helps you see the different angles you might have missed.
What is 'System 1' and 'System 2' thinking in this context?
This comes from psychologist Daniel Kahneman. System 1 is fast, instinctive, and emotional (Quick Answering). System 2 is slower, more deliberative, and logical (Question Interpretation). Mastery is essentially training your System 1 to be as accurate as your System 2 through thousands of hours of practice.
